
A few dilapidated barracks surrounded by weeds is all that remains of the "sub-camp", where historians say 35,800 detainees -- many of them Polish -- were worked to death. Much to the surprise of the Austrian government, the Polish Embassy in Austria said in December it wanted to buy the partly private land that hosted the site.
